摘要
为了提高高压电力线路交叉跨越时封网带电跨越施工的安全性,合理设计封网带电跨越施工方案,为架空输电线路不停电跨越施工提供技术支持。根据悬链线模型与力学基本原理,提出了封网情况下承载索的张力、弧垂通用计算方法,能够计算承力索任意一点的张力与弧垂,各种封网型式下的净空距离。通过该计算方法,可以计算封网跨越中的关键参数,为输电线路跨越线路设计提供技术支撑。根据实际工程进行实例验证,所提出的算法是正确并有效的,可为实际应用提供指导。
In order to improve the safety of the construction of the high-voltage power line crossing with electricity,a reasonable construction scheme of live crossing construction is designed to provide technical support for the construction of overhead transmission lines without power failure.According to the catenary model and the basic principle of mechanics,a general calculation method for the tension and sag of the carrying rope with the netword closure is proposed,which can calculate the tension and sag of the carrying rope at any point,and the clearance distance under various types of network closure.Through the calculation method,the key parameters of the transmission line crossing calculated,which can provide technical support for the design of transmission lines acrossing.According to project verification,the proposed algorithm is correct and effective,which can provide guidance for practical application.
